Because cheap drones are vulnerable not only mechanically but also electronically, the "brute force method" for destruction is fairly easy. For semiconductor devices only peak value (voltage, current) matters so any microwave device producing enough peak power can disable a drone (by destroying the electronics). IOW average power use of such destructive devices can be low and run from mobile platforms.
